Objectives

The general aims of the course of Orthodontic Sciences II provide the following core competencies :

- Ensure the appropriate knowledge of the basic science of orthodontics to allow recognize deviations from normal dentition and craniofacial growth;

- Develop knowledge on issues related to the malocclusion and biological bases of tooth movement and orthopedic dentofacial;

- Being able to diagnose dentition abnormalities , craniofacial structures and functional conditions.

Learning outcomes and competences

The contents are oriented in the sense that at the end of the course the student is the holder of the knowledge, skills and competencies that enable to recognize deviations from the normal development of the dentition and craniofacial growth, relate malocclusion and biological bases of tooth movement and orthopedic dentofacial and be able to diagnose dentition abnormalities , craniofacial structures and functional conditions. It seeks to create theoretical basis that built the progressivity of scientific and clinical knowledge in the field of orthodontics specialty, contributing to a scientifically more effective practice.

Program

- Deformity dentofacial ;

- The Class I syndromes , II1 , II2 , III ;

- The cross- bite, open bite , deep bite ;

- Early orthodontic treatment , orthodontic-surgical , orthognathic-surgical orthodontic; ortho- perio ;

- Orthodontic problem of third molars ;

- Guidelines for assessing the severity of orthodontic anomalies ;

- The biological basis of orthopedic therapy dentofacial ;

- Orthodontics , deontology and social and professional communication;

- The management in orthodontic activity.
